A car fax only shows, what has been reported to the DMV. If someonce crashed a car, had no police report written, and fixed it without involving insurance, nothing would show on the car fax. Perhaps that's what happened with the CGT at Park Place? I agree that car fax isn't 100% reliable but it did prevent me from pursuing a bad car a few times.
Sometimes a car is fixed so right that it's as good or better than out of the box. It all boils down to a p.p.i to find out how good the car is and how the price reflects loss of value due to accident. However, for an expensive car like the CGT, Id prefer a pristine, cherry,virgin e.g.

If your talking about the car at Park Place is WA it had $100k in repairs from a accident, which can be a couple panles on a CGT. A good number of these cars are wrecked and that's why the prices are all over the map.I know a couple pristine exapmples that recently sold in the 350-360 range with under 5k.
Carfax is not very accurate, and autocheck can be more accurate but anyone can run their Carrera GT into a tree. Tow it to their house and have it repaired and never have anything show on car fax or autocheck.
Correct. Always best to have a ppi, and if a car checks out with a ppi and has a bad carfax or autocheck this could be beneficial to the buyer, save $$. All i can say is i will never buy a car based on what those reports say. The integrity of the car will speak for itself. That's what works for me.

Color is a factor in pricing as well. GT Silver is by far the most common color and you can pay a premium for some of the more rare colors. BTW, I only see 2 on Manhattan's website. Both GT Silver.
